Machine Zone , a global leader in mobile gaming, today announced the global launch of Final Fantasy XV: War for Eos, a free-to-play mobile strategy MMORPG where players jump into the action with Noctis, Luna, and their favorite FFXV characters.

  • Players can expect epic character combat campaigns where they will build and customize empires, and go to war with and against other guilds to protect the Crystal and reign the Realm.

PARK CITY, Utah, Aug. 29, 2022 /PRNewswire/ -- Limit Break Inc., a company founded by Gabriel Leydon and Halbert Nakagawa, announces it has raised $200 million dollars in investment capital from Buckley Ventures, Standard Crypto, and Paradigm Ventures.

  • Limit Break, known for the DigiDaigaku NFT collection, also raised from investors including FTX, Coinbase Ventures, Anthos Capital, SV Angel, and Shervin Pishevar.
  • Leydon and Nakagawa are known as pioneers of "Free-to-Play" gaming, but are taking a completely new turn with Limit Break.
  • Its name was inspired by the "Limit Break" combat sequence popularized in RPG games like the Final Fantasy series.

LAS VEGAS, April 6, 2022 /PRNewswire/ -- Today, Streamline Media Group (Streamline), a video games and digital asset developer and services company, announces its expansion into Japan. Former Third Party Relations VP of Sony Interactive Entertainment (SIE) Japan Asia, Kenji Kajiwara, is now the General Manager, Head of Japan for Streamline's new office.

  • At Streamline, Kenji Kajiwara will continue to support Streamline's Japan partners, develop new relationships, and build a locally based development team in Tokyo, Japan to solidify Streamline's services in the region.
  • Streamline Media Group is an independent company specializing in creative and technical R&D solutions for video games, media, entertainment, and enterprise.
